Proper Vent Stack Height for Plumbing Systems: Essential Guidelines for Residential Installations

The vent stack plays a crucial role in a building's plumbing system, ensuring proper venting and preventing backdrafts. However, how high should a vent stack be above the roof? In this article, we will explore the critical guidelines set by the Uniform Plumbing Code (UPC), and how local regulations can impact this measurement.

Understanding the Uniform Plumbing Code (UPC)

The Uniform Plumbing Code is a widely recognized standard in the plumbing industry, providing a comprehensive set of rules and regulations for plumbing systems. One of the key aspects covered by the UPC is the height requirement for vent stacks. According to the code, vent stacks must terminate a minimum of 6 inches above the roof.

Additional Considerations: Snow Accumulation

While the base requirement is straightforward, there are additional factors to consider, particularly in areas with significant snowfall. The UPC stipulates that vent stacks should terminate 6 inches above the roof or 6 inches above the anticipated snow accumulation, whichever value is greater. This ensures that the vent stack remains functional during harsh winter conditions.

Determining Snow Accumulation: A Local Responsibility

The exact amount of anticipated snow accumulation varies by location and can significantly impact the final measurement of your vent stack. Local building departments play a crucial role in determining the snow accumulation threshold for your specific area. This information is essential for ensuring compliance with local regulations and preventing potential damages during heavy snowfall.

Ensuring Compliance with Local Building Codes

While the UPC provides a baseline for vent stack height, local building departments are typically responsible for enforcing these codes and regulations. They have the authority to set more stringent requirements if necessary. For example, in regions with extremely heavy snowfall, local building codes may require vent stacks to reach higher above the roof to ensure proper function and safety.

Best Practices for Installing Vent Stacks

To ensure that your vent stack installation meets all the necessary requirements, follow these best practices:

Consult Local Building Codes: Always check with your local building department to understand the specific requirements for your area. Use High-Quality Materials: Invest in durable materials that can withstand the weather conditions and last for years without requiring repairs. Professional Installation: Hire a licensed and experienced plumber to install your vent stack to ensure it is done correctly and safely. Regular Maintenance: Perform regular inspections and maintenance to keep your vent stack in optimal condition.
